Abstract

The utility model discloses a novel medullary cavity expander. The novel medullary cavity expander comprises a wrench, a handle sleeve, a connection rod, a reamer, a reaming drill and a bolt. The novel medullary cavity expander is characterized in that the wrench and the connection rod are of an integrated structure, one end of the connection rod is connected with the wrench, the bolt is arranged at the other end of the connection rod, the connection rod is sleeved with the handle sleeve, the connection rod is fixedly connected with the reamer through the bolt, the reaming drill is arranged at one end of the reamer, and a hexagon cylinder is arranged at the other end of the reaming drill; a hexagon groove is formed in the tail end of the connection rod, the hexagon groove in the tail end of the connection rod is matched with the hexagon cylinder on the reamer, the hexagon cylinder on the reamer is provided with a through hole, the top of the bolt is hexagon, a screw cap on the bolt is hexagon, and the handle sleeve is provide with an arc groove. The novel medullary cavity expander is reasonable in design, simple in structure and convenient to use.

Background technology
In long-term clinical practice, the use of the interior technique for fixing of intramedullary needle is increasingly extensive, but pulp cavity reaming apparatus still has weak point, and the widely used medullary cavity enlarging device stability of institute is inadequate at present, easily causes deflection, can cause intramedullary needle malposition in pulp cavity.
The utility model content
In view of the foregoing, this utility model provides a kind of novel medullary cavity enlarging device, and connecting rod 3 is provided with handle jacket 2, and left hand is held sleeve, can guarantee the stability of medullary cavity enlarging device.

The specific embodiment
In conjunction with Fig. 1, present embodiment is described, a kind of novel medullary cavity enlarging device, comprise: spanner 1, handle jacket 2, connecting rod 3, reamer 4, strand brill 5, bolt 6, wherein, spanner 1 is the integral type structure with connecting rod 3, connecting rod 3 one ends are connected with spanner 1, the other end is provided with bolt 6, and handle jacket 2 is enclosed within on connecting rod 3, and connecting rod 3 is bolted to connection with reamer 4, reamer 4 one ends bore 5 for strand, and reamer 4 other ends are the hexagon cylinder.
In this utility model, connecting rod 3 ends are provided with hexagonal indentations, the hexagonal indentations of connecting rod 3 ends and the hexagon cylinder on reamer 4 coincide, hexagon cylinder on reamer 4 is provided with through hole, bolt 6 tops are hexagon, cap nut on bolt 6 is hexagon, and handle jacket 2 is provided with arc groove.
During use, hexagon cylinder on reamer 4 inserts in the hexagonal indentations of connecting rod 3 ends, is tightened after bolt 6 is passed through hole on the hexagon cylinder, left hand is held handle jacket 2, and the right hand is held spanner 1, can carry out reaming, good stability, accurate positioning.
